I Remember Mama: Musical Info & Synopsis


Synopsis:

I Remember Mama follows the Hansen family, with a focus on their daughter Katrin. From Katrin’s perspective, we witness the family’s struggles, including the threat of losing their home, while also celebrating the central figure of Mama. The musical captures the essence of immigrant life, emphasizing the importance of family bonds and the resilience found in love and support.

Musical Information

Musical Type: Pre-Contemporary (1979)

Cast Size: 12+

Genre: Dramedy

Setting: 1910s / USA (California)


Creative Team

Music: Richard Rodgers

Lyrics: Martin Charnin

Book: Thomas Meehan

Additional Lyrics: Raymond Jessel

Based On: Mama’s Bank Account➝ by Kathryn Forbes
